Affordable Estates to Live in Nairobi If You Work in Nairobi CBD

Working in Nairobi CBD comes with one major challenge—finding affordable housing close enough to cut down on long commutes, but still within your budget. Thankfully, several estates within or near the city offer affordable bedsitters and one-bedroom apartments that suit young professionals, small families, or anyone looking to live close to town. Below is a guide to the best affordable estates and their average rental prices.

1. Ngara

Ngara is one of the most popular estates close to the CBD, just a short matatu ride or even walking distance. It attracts students and young professionals due to its affordability and proximity.

  • Bedsitter: KSh 8,000 – 15,000 (some furnished studios go higher, up to KSh 25,000+).
  • One-Bedroom: KSh 15,000 – 40,000 depending on finish and security.

2. Pangani

Pangani is an old but vibrant neighborhood that offers direct access to the CBD in under 15 minutes. Many professionals choose it because of the short commute.

  • Bedsitter: KSh 9,000 – 14,000.
  • One-Bedroom: KSh 15,000 – 25,000.

3. South B & South C

South B and South C are considered mid-income neighborhoods but still provide affordable options compared to Kilimani or Westlands. They are well-connected by Mombasa Road and offer security, schools, and good social amenities.

  • South B Bedsitter: KSh 14,000 – 18,000.
  • South B One-Bedroom: KSh 20,000 – 35,000.
  • South C Bedsitter: KSh 16,000 – 20,000.
  • South C One-Bedroom: KSh 25,000 – 45,000.

4. Donholm

Donholm lies along Jogoo Road, less than 30 minutes to town during off-peak hours. It’s a favorite for middle-class workers who want affordable rent with decent infrastructure.

  • Bedsitter: KSh 6,500 – 9,000.
  • One-Bedroom: KSh 10,000 – 20,000.

5. Buruburu

Buruburu is one of Nairobi’s oldest estates, well-planned and popular with families and young professionals alike. Rent is slightly higher than Donholm but still affordable compared to estates closer to Upper Hill or Kilimani.

  • Bedsitter: KSh 6,000 – 7,500.
  • One-Bedroom: KSh 12,000 – 20,000.

6. Pipeline (Embakasi)

Pipeline is famous for its high-rise apartments and budget-friendly rent. It’s one of the cheapest places to live near town, although congestion can be a challenge.

  • Bedsitter: KSh 5,000 – 9,000.
  • One-Bedroom: KSh 12,000 – 15,000.

7. Fedha Estate (Embakasi)

Fedha is slightly more organized than Pipeline and appeals to those looking for a quieter residential experience while still close to town via Outering Road.

  • Bedsitter: KSh 8,000 – 12,000.
  • One-Bedroom: KSh 15,000 – 22,000.

8. Ruaraka

Located along Thika Road, Ruaraka offers affordable housing and easy commuting to town by matatu or the Thika Superhighway.

  • Bedsitter: KSh 8,000 – 12,000.
  • One-Bedroom: KSh 15,000 – 25,000.

 

9. Kariokor & Shauri Moyo

These estates are among the most affordable within walking distance of Nairobi CBD. They offer basic but budget-friendly housing, perfect for workers who want to save on transport.

  • Bedsitter: KSh 6,000 – 9,000.
  • One-Bedroom: KSh 12,000 – 18,000.

10. Ruaka

Although technically outside Nairobi, Ruaka has grown rapidly due to its proximity to Two Rivers Mall and its connection to Limuru Road. It attracts professionals who work in CBD but prefer modern apartments.

  • Bedsitter: KSh 12,000 – 18,000 (rare to find).
  • One-Bedroom: KSh 18,000 – 50,000 depending on development.

Final Thoughts

If you work in Nairobi CBD, estates like Ngara, Pangani, Kariokor, Buruburu, and Pipeline offer the most budget-friendly options for bedsitters and one-bedrooms. For those willing to pay slightly more for better security and amenities, South B, South C, and Ruaka are excellent alternatives.

When choosing where to live, balance your rent budget, transport costs, and lifestyle needs. Living closer to town may mean higher rent, but you save money and time on daily commuting.
